Some people might think that installing a whole house reverse osmosis system is overkill. However, it is not overkill to put your family's safety first in this day and age, and a unit like this may be the best way to do just that.

It would probably help with understanding what a unit is and what it does. When you are installing units similar to these types, a large filtration and purification tank will be installed outside of your home by your main water supply. This tank will then treat all of the supply that enters your home, whether that supply will end up in a drinking glass or being flushed down the toilet. The biggest cost of these units will be the installation; after that, there is very minimal maintenance year after year.

The benefits of installing this type of system range from protecting your health to saving money. Yes, spending the money on a these units can actually save you money in the long run, and here is how. Some water carries so many contaminants that it becomes harmful to plumbing and appliances. Washing machines, toilets, shower heads, faucets, and dishwashers all have to be replaced much more quickly. These appliances are not cheap. One washing machine could cost the same as the entire system. If your plumbing wears out and it may need to be replaced, the costs could be phenomenal depending on what collateral damage takes place before the problem is discovered. For example, if the contaminants in water cause a pipe to rust, leak, and burst, you not only have to replace the pipe, but you will probably also have to replace drywall and repaint. These types of home improvements cost an arm and a leg, and that is assuming the damage was contained.

The health benefits of installing a whole house reverse osmosis system should be considered also. Drinking supply should absolutely be purified, whether it comes from the municipal tanks or an underground well. However, other water might be hazardous over time as well since it does come in contact with the inhabitants in a home. For example, shower water and the water you brush your teeth with might not be considered necessary for purification purposes, but why not? Some contaminants can do damage over time no matter the method in which we come into contact with them.
